Papal resignation causes global disbelief, grief
RIO DE JANEIRO -- Roman Catholics around the world expressed disbelief and grief Monday at the first papal resignation in six centuries. Some saw it as a dramatic act of humility, others as a sign of crisis in the Roman Catholic Church. And many expressed hope that a more energetic and charismatic new pope would lead the church into a new era.
